What’s New for 2007: Camelback Ski Area
Author thumbnail By M. Scott Smith, DCSki Editor

Pennsylvania’s Camelback Ski Area has improved lighting at the Oak Grove Halfpipe, and plans to install two 650-foot long handle tows at the Rhodo Terrain Park and the Oak Grove Halfpipe.

Camelback has also installed a Magic Carpet conveyor lift at the Tubing Park. The number of chutes has been increased to 14 with the addition of two single chutes and one family chute.

550 pairs of replacement skis have been purchased for the rental shop, along with 200 new Burton snowboards. Camelback has also purchased 30 pairs of ladies progression boots for the rental shop.
